Overview

Postcode NW1 9AT is located in a major urban area, within the Camden Square ward of Camden in the London region, and forms part of the Camden Road South area. It has moderate deprivation and very high crime levels, with around 144.4 crimes per 1,000 residents per year. The average income per household in Camden Road South is £66,700 per year. The nearest station is Caledonian Road located about 0.4 miles away. There are 13 primary and 2 secondary schools in the area. There are 7 parks nearby, closest medium park is Caledonian Park.

Property prices in Camden Square

Based on 44 recent sales, the median property price is £679,650 in Camden Square area, with individual transactions ranging from £280,000 up to £26,000,000.
